This researcher works primarily on materials for clean energy and environmental applications, especially photocatalysts and electrocatalysts that use light or electricity to drive chemical reactions such as converting CO2 into fuels, producing hydrogen gas, or breaking down pollutants and antibiotics in water. The publication record also includes some unrelated topics (e.g., food science, PCR-based meat testing, optics), suggesting the name may be associated with multiple contributors or collaborations across different fields. Prospective students interested in nanomaterials for solar-driven chemistry, water treatment, or catalyst design would find the core body of work most relevant.
